A Music Career in Review

6 minutes of the story of my music career!

In recent weeks I’ve been doing a lot of digital clean up, digging out old hard drives and master CDs and career clippings. Wow have I been a hoarder and archivist! Not always super organised, but most everything I ever made is still on hard drives in my possession (and backed up to the cloud, fear not). Found so many amazing things, memories, old friends. Lots of those have been shared to my Instagram as reels (@jamesalexander_live). It’s been a time of great integration and reconnection for me, and it’s been a really heart-warming journey down memory lane piecing this story of my career together.

The best is certainly yet to come, but for now, here is a brief summary of the things I’ve been up to musically for the last 25 years. Now that I have finished publishing my first novel The Ghost of Emily here as a weekly episodic series, I’m taking a few weeks to focus my energies on this website on my music.

First it was this video, next I’ll be building my EPK (that’s Electronic Press Kit for people not in the business) here on this site, so that agents, venues, and other industry bods can easily access my current bio, photos, and promo like this short documentary and my best performance highlights.

After that, I’m planning to gradually “re-release” my entire back catalog here on Substack, linking in with my BandCamp which hosts all of my original music released to date.
